Welcome aboard! This revamp of the Quillport password reset flow replaces the old single-token scheme with short-lived, single-use tokens plus a cooldown between requests. Main thing to check: the throttle logic in `reset_guard.go` — we got burned before by users spamming the reset button and flooding the mailer. Everything is configurable, so don't hardcode anything new. The relevant tuning constants are shown below for reference.

tuning constants:
QUOTAS = {
    "druwyn": 5,
    "holix": 5,
    "zorath": 5,
    "holwyn": 10,
}

We pin an exact version rather than a range because
// the library ships inline event handlers whose CSP hashes are computed at
// build time; a silent minor bump would invalidate those hashes and break
// the content security policy in production. Any change here must go
// through security review, and the reviewer should confirm the hash
// manifest was regenerated. The library build this constant corresponds to
// is listed below.

pipeline stamp: htk9_ce63042d9

## Gross-Margin Review FY-Close (Managers Only)

Prepared for the board. Consolidated gross margin landed at 41.2%, down 180 basis points year over year, driven mainly by input-cost inflation on the Selwyn product family and freight surcharges from the Carden route. Pricing actions taken in Q4 recovered roughly half the erosion. Further mitigation options are under evaluation. The resulting direction for our business plans is summarized in the confidential note below.

confidential, bahap-bajog: Zorethix Works is in early talks to buy Kelethox Foods for about $30.7 million. The Ralvan launch date is September 19, and nothing goes to the press before then.

## Changelog — Exportery 2.9

Defaults for export retry behavior have changed. Failed exports are now retried automatically with exponential backoff instead of requiring a manual re-run. Support should expect fewer tickets about stuck exports, but customers may notice delayed delivery rather than an outright failure. Retries are capped, after which the export is marked failed and the customer is notified. Exports that fail validation are never retried. The new default values shipping with this release are listed below.

settings of tagef-bawif:
DRUIX_HOST=druix.zemvarlabs.internal
DRUIX_PORT=8000